Q How fast is a cable modem connection?
A A DOCSIS 3.0 cable modem offers Internet access at speeds up to four times faster than traditional cable modem services and hundreds times faster than a traditional telephone modem. Depending on the service offering you have subscribed to, you can experience speeds of over 100 Mbps. Network conditions such as traffic volume and the speed of the sites you visit can affect download speeds.
Q Can I still watch cable TV while using my cable modem?
A Yes, your cable TV line can carry the TV signal while you send and receive information on the Internet.

Q What is DOCSIS 3.0?
A DOCSIS 3.0 (Data Over Cable System Interface Specification) is the new standard for communication in Cable Networks. Your Internet access via your Cable Network uses channels, much like the TV channels you watch, for data transport. Your DOCSIS
3.0SB6120 Cable Modem sends and receives information in both directions on these data channels. Using the newest technology, a cable provider can link multiple channels together (channel bonding) to greatly increase data transfer rates to and from your computer using the SB6120 through the Cable Network.
